Importance of Antarctic Geology in Climate Change Studies

Antarctic geology plays a crucial role in studying climate change, as the continent's ice sheets provide a record of past climate patterns. By studying the layers of ice, scientists can reconstruct past climate conditions and better understand the causes and effects of climate change. Additionally, the geological features of Antarctica offer insights into how the continent has responded to climate change in the past, providing valuable information for predicting future climate patterns.

As such, Antarctic geology is a key component in global efforts to understand and address climate change.

Valuable Minerals Found in Antarctica

Antarctica is home to a variety of valuable minerals, including coal, iron ore, copper, and gold. These resources have the potential to be valuable assets for the global economy. However, the extreme weather conditions and challenging environment make extraction and exploration difficult. Despite these challenges, the potential rewards of discovering and extracting these valuable minerals make Antarctica an enticing destination for resource exploration.

It is important to balance the potential benefits of resource extraction with the need to protect the fragile Antarctic ecosystem.
